Pearl jewellery is a classic, carrying an elegance and majesty that has attracted women of every generation. Very few pieces of jewellery are timeless, but ask any buyer and they’ll tell you, pearls are treasured forever.

Pearls are found in the sea, before being crafted with meticulous care into their exquisite form. There are many imitations, but a true pearl is unmistakable, and natural pearl jewellery has found its way from the waters to the red carpet, time and time again.

Here are some examples of the world’s most iconic fashionistas, wearing some of the world’s most iconic natural pearls.

Jackie Kennedy

Jacqueline Kennedy Onassis was more than just the first lady to the 35th President of the United States of America, she was an iconic, ambitious woman in her own right.

Jackie’s style influenced an entire nation of young women, especially when she was seen wearing one of her favourite pieces, the pearl necklace. Pearls have never been so popular as when they found their way into the White House.

Coco Chanel

Perhaps the biggest influence in the fashion industry, Coco Chanel was the only name worth knowing once she made her mark on fashion, fragrance, and took the world by storm.

Chanel is unmistakably the highest authority in fashion and style, and takes the up most pride in wearing her signature pearl necklaces. From the red carpet to her own photo shoots, natural pearls were always the perfect compliment to the little black dress.

Madonna

In reverence of the aforementioned Coco Chanel, Madonna gave her fair share of adoration to natural pearl jewellery as well, as an elegant offset to the little black dress.

The ‘Vogue’ singer was at one point the music industry’s chief influence on fashion and culture, whilst being one of the most successful female solo artists of all time. Madonna left her mark with a style that set her apart from every other singer, and gave her music new meaning.

Lady Gaga

Regarded by many as the new queen of pop, Stefani Joanne Angelina Germanotta, better known as Lady Gaga, didn’t take long after her first hit single before making headlines with her outlandish fashion statements.

Alongside a whole host of outstanding and somewhat controversial outfit choices, Gaga maintained her love of natural pearls, sporting a wide array of necklaces, bracelets and even face-pearls throughout her illustrious and incomparably extravagant career.

Natalie Portman

When pearls came to Hollywood, they were worn by the red carpet’s most elegant starlets, one of whom is Academy Award winning actress Natalie Portman.

The ‘Black Swan’ star made headlines when she graced the cover Harper’s Bazaar in October 2006, wearing a beautiful set of natural pearl necklaces. Portman’s cover was a tribute to Audrey Hepburn’s starring role in 1961’s ‘Breakfast at Tiffany’s’, for which Hepburn wore the same black column dress.

Freshwater pearls are found in rivers and lakes as opposed to the saltwater variety, which are found in oceans. Freshwater pearl jewellery carries the same beauty expected of natural pearls, but they are much more affordable than the commonly worn saltwater pearls.
